In recent years, the proliferation of remote work and online schooling has meant that people are spending more time in front of screens than ever before. According to studies, the average adult spends around 10 hours a day on various screens, including smartphones, tablets, computers, and televisions. This extended screen time can take a toll on ocular health, leading to symptoms such as digital eye strain, eye fatigue, and blurred vision. Moreover, another fascinating trend linked to the rise of screen-focused lifestyles is the growing emphasis on holistic approaches to eye care. Individuals increasingly recognize that maintaining optimal eye health involves more than just popping a pill. Many are exploring lifestyle modifications, such as implementing the 20-20-20 rule—taking a 20-second break to look at something 20 feet away every 20 minutes spent staring at a screen. This approach acknowledges the need for lifestyle adjustments alongside nutritional support to combat the potential adverse effects of prolonged screen time.
